Statement of Environmental Defense Fund Senior Director of Strategic Planning Elgie Holstein on EPA Superfund Announcement
EDF Senior Director of Strategic Planning Elgie Holstein Released the Following Statement in Response to EPA Administrator Scott Pruitt's announcement of Superfund sites targeted for cleanup.
"Secretary Pruitt’s announcement is little more than holiday wrapping paper around words.
"It doesn’t propose a dollar more to help large and complicated cleanups move forward—and it doesn’t change the fact that Pruitt and the Trump Administration are working to slash the program’s budget by 30% and enforcement efforts by 37%, and are also working to eliminate the jobs of public health experts and engineers who help solve these highly complex problems.
"There are real and desperately needed ways to improve Superfund. This doesn’t come near passing the test.”
